The Department of Justice, specifically the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ives (ATF), is seeking professional support services for the installation and maintenance of Team Awareness Kits (TAK) to enhance its operational capabilities. The primary objective is to improve situational awareness for approximately 2,500 users by integrating advanced technology that supports up to 1,000 simultaneous users across secure data channels, including live video streams and remote sensors. This initiative is crucial for modernizing ATF's tools in combating violent crime and ensuring community safety.
